如何克隆GitHub上的仓库到本地

在软件开发的过程中,使用版本控制工具来管理项目的代码是至关重要的。GitHub作为最流行的代码托管平台,提供了丰富的功能,允许开发者在全球范围内共享和管理代码。本篇文章将详细介绍如何克隆GitHub上的仓库到本地,步骤简单易懂,让您迅速上手。

1. 什么是Git和GitHub

在深入克隆仓库之前,我们首先要了解一些基本概念。

  • Git:一种分布式版本控制系统,可以记录文件的变化,帮助团队协作。
  • GitHub:一个基于Git的代码托管平台,提供了Web界面和众多功能,方便开发者管理代码库。

2. 准备工作

在克隆GitHub仓库之前,您需要确保以下准备工作已完成:

  • 安装Git:确保您已经在本地计算机上安装了Git。可以通过运行git --version来检查是否已成功安装。
  • 注册GitHub账户:若您尚未注册,可以访问GitHub官网进行注册。

3. 找到要克隆的GitHub仓库

您可以在GitHub上搜索到您感兴趣的项目,找到相应的仓库后,打开它的主页。在页面的右上角,您会看到一个绿色的“Code”按钮,点击它可以看到克隆链接。

4. 克隆GitHub仓库的步骤

4.1 获取克隆链接

  • 点击绿色的“Code”按钮,您会看到一个弹出窗口,其中有多个选项:HTTPS、SSH和GitHub CLI。
  • 根据自己的需要选择链接方式,通常推荐使用HTTPS。

4.2 打开命令行界面

  • Windows:可以使用命令提示符或PowerShell。
  • macOSLinux:可以使用终端。

4.3 输入克隆命令

在命令行中,输入以下命令来克隆仓库:

bash git clone [克隆链接]

例如:

bash git clone https://github.com/username/repository.git

4.4 访问克隆后的仓库

克隆完成后,您会在本地生成一个与仓库同名的文件夹,您可以进入该文件夹开始进行开发。

bash cd repository

5. 常见问题解答(FAQ)

5.1 如何克隆私有仓库?

若要克隆私有仓库,您需要使用SSH或者GitHub提供的个人访问令牌(PAT)。在设置了SSH密钥或获取PAT后,使用与公共仓库相同的命令克隆即可。

5.2 克隆仓库时出现错误怎么办?

如果在克隆过程中遇到错误,可以尝试以下步骤:

  • 确认克隆链接是否正确。
  • 检查网络连接是否正常。
  • 若使用SSH,确保您的SSH密钥已正确配置并添加到GitHub。

5.3 我可以克隆多个仓库吗?

当然可以,您可以在命令行中多次使用git clone命令来克隆多个仓库,也可以通过在不同文件夹中分别克隆。只需确保每个仓库的名称不重复。

5.4 如何更新已克隆的仓库?

在已克隆的仓库文件夹中,您可以使用以下命令来更新:

bash git pull origin master

这将从远程主分支拉取最新的更改。

6. 小结

克隆GitHub上的仓库到本地是软件开发过程中不可或缺的一部分。通过本文的步骤,您应该能够轻松地完成这一操作并进行后续的开发工作。如有任何疑问,欢迎查阅GitHub的官方文档或向社区寻求帮助。

希望本篇文章能够帮助您更好地使用GitHub进行项目管理,提升开发效率!

正文完